To achieve net-zero carbon emissions, the Transportation Bureau has built smart roadside charging parking columns, which can replenish electricity when parking. (Photo by reporter Lin Xuejuan)

Reporter Lin Xuejuan/Reporting from Tainan

With the recent high temperatures in Tainan, how to save energy and reduce carbon emissions has become a top priority. The city government’s Transportation Bureau said that in the face of the climate crisis and the trend of net-zero carbon emissions, Tainan has set short-, medium-, and long-range net-zero goals and paths, and a goal of 100% intelligent on-street parking spaces. It will be the first in the country to be completed.

The Transportation Bureau stated that Tainan was the first city in the country to enact the low-carbon concept into law and to establish Taiwan’s first smart roadside parking billing system. Currently, 87% of the city’s roadside paid parking systems are smart, ranking first in the country. crown.

Nanshi’s smart roadside parking billing system saves 3.81 million paper parking receipts every year, which is equivalent to reducing 4.5 tons of carbon dioxide emissions. It also sets up a smart parking cloud data platform to help drivers reduce five to six minutes of searching for empty parking spaces. Time, in the past three years, the cumulative reduction of carbon emissions from vehicle detours has been 1,070 tons, effectively reducing traffic congestion and air pollution.

There are 15,000 roadside paid smart parking spaces, 4,000 smart parking posts and 9,000 geomagnetic detector seats, for a total of 13,000 seats, a ratio of 87%, ranking first in the country.

Since the relevant billing system was launched, it has increased the parking turnover rate by 69% and the utilization rate by 59%, reducing the waste of vacant parking spaces. It also provides on-site payment services, with 40% of people paying on-site, paperless automatic billing, and real-time information. Reduce vehicle detour time and comply with SDG11 “Sustainable Cities and Communities” standards.

In addition, diversified payment channels have replaced the past supermarket collection and cash charges at the counter. In the past three years, 17.48 million payment receipts have been saved, and carbon dioxide emissions have been reduced by 21.8 tons.

Taiwan has proposed a 2050 net-zero emission policy. In response to the rapid increase in electric vehicles and the resulting charging demand around the world, parking posts and charging piles have been integrated to build “smart roadside charging parking posts.” Currently, roadside parking spaces in Tainan City have been Forty-three seats are completed, and electricity can be replenished when parking, promoting Tainan’s net-zero transformation and echoing the United Nations sustainable development indicators.
